文件名称:基于 Linux Socket 和 JSON 的服务器与客户端文件传输
文件大小:46.79MB
文件格式:ZIP
更新时间:2019-11-24 13:58:01
Linux Socket、Json
linux 下的 Socket 服务器同时与多个客户端进行文件传输, 其中客户端用 Qt 编写的, 可以在Ubuntu 和 Windows 下运行。服务器代码可以在 ubuntu 下运行, 也可以用交叉编译器编译在 ARM 下运行。命令与数据端口分开处理, 命令的传输使用 Json 格式
【文件预览】:
Socket_File_Transfer
----Client()
--------client()
--------build-Client-Desktop_Qt_5_7_0_GCC_64bit-Debug()
----收发的消息格式.txt(2KB)
----ubuntu..jpg(188KB)
----Server()
--------server.c(4KB)
--------server(42KB)
--------data.h(936B)
--------data_thread.h(116B)
--------cJSON.h(7KB)
--------data_thread.c(3KB)
--------cmd_thread.h(112B)
--------cJSON.c(27KB)
--------data.c(887B)
--------Server.sh(103B)
--------cmd_thread.c(6KB)
--------tool.h(532B)
--------tool.c(3KB)
----windows.jpg(85KB)